About Pooja Vijayaraghavan

Pooja Vijayaraghavan is a scholar working on Infectious Diseases, Pharmacology and Plant Science, having authored 26 papers that have together received 260 indexed citations. Recurring topics across this work include Antifungal resistance and susceptibility (14 papers), Mycotoxins in Agriculture and Food (6 papers) and Fungal Biology and Applications (6 papers). The work is most often cited by research in Drug Discovery (1 citation), Pharmacology (28 citations) and Infectious Diseases (59 citations). Pooja Vijayaraghavan has collaborated with scholars based in India, United Arab Emirates and China. Frequent co-authors include Lovely Gupta, Jata Shankar, Shraddha Tiwari, Asish K. Bhattacharya, Alok Gupta, Raman Thakur, Gaurav Raj, Rajesh K. Joshi, Zhen Wang and S. Ignacimuthu.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Journal of Applied Microbiology.
